WE SAY
For a band apparently determined to make themselves completely invisible to Google, French-Irish electro-pop duo 'R' are doing a pretty good job of getting heard on the radio. Their quiet, understated debut Change was originally championed by 6 Music's Steve Lamacq on his Roundtable Review show, accurately describing it as a 'terrifically charming piece of music', while guest reviewer Martyn Ware (Heaven 17, Human League) said it 'restored his faith in the future of songwriting in Britain' - not bad from the man who co-wrote Temptation. Produced by Konstantine Pope, Change has just ended its fourth week on the 6 Music playlist, while FM radio is picking up with plays from Huw Stephens and Phil & Alice at Radio 1, Janice Long at Radio 2, with support from Today FM and 2fm in Ireland. R is a collaboration between brothers Pierre and Marc O'Reilly, the former a respected film composer, the latter a talented folk-blues artist whom you can catch solo at The Islington tomorrow (October 18).
